Andrew Clarke being presented the BRCGS CEO Award by Mark Proctor at Food Safety Americas 2019

BRCGS are pleased to announce their 2019 CEO Award was presented to Andrew Clarke, Senior Director, Quality Assurance – Control Brands at Loblaw Companies Limited, at their Food Safety Americas conference in Coronado Bay, California in May.

This award is in recognition of the commitment demonstrated by Andrew in expanding the reach of the BRCGS Standards and certification scheme throughout North America.

This year was the first time the award has been presented to an individual for their support of using the Standard to help the industry. Andrew has been a long-term supporter of the BRCGS programs and organization, wherever possible bringing the benefits of the BRCGS tools to organizations he represents.

Andrew Clarke, Senior Director, Quality Assurance – Control Brands at Loblaw Companies, said: 'I'm very honored and humbled to receive the BRCGS CEO Award and proud to see the progress with the BRCGS START! program in Latin America. As an actual user and specifier of the BRCGS Standards for many years, their continued advancement and evolution tackling industry challenges has been incredibly beneficial in supplier assurance programs I have managed, including my present role at Loblaws. I'm proud to continue to provide input as a member of the BRCGS International Advisory Board and look forward to seeing the continued progression with the BRCGS START! program as it guides businesses to improve their programs while contributing to raising food safety standards globally.'

The CEO Award was initiated by BRCGS' CEO, Mark Proctor, to recognize the most promising certification body partner that has driven extensive business growth. As BRCGS continues to expand, so do the awards and recognitions. This year the focus was still on driving business growth but, in this case, it was a deliberate recognition of an individual who has played a similar role.

Mark Proctor, CEO of BRCGS, said: 'The BRCGS Food Safety (Americas) Awards Program is committed to recognizing both individuals and corporations who strive for excellence in food safety standards. I'm delighted that Andrew Clarke was awarded the CEO Award at this year's conference. The award recognizes Andrew's excellent contribution as a member of our International Advisory Board for the Americas and his commitment to the BRCGS Standards. It also recognizes, while working at Subway, his instigation of the BRCGS START! LATAM project for Subway's 450 suppliers, with deployment of the first BRCGS START! audits in February this year.'
